The size of Mount Barker is approximately 488.0 square kilometres. It has 16 parks covering nearly 0.4% of total area. The population of Mount Barker in 2016 was 2741 people. By 2021 the population was 2855 showing a population growth of 4.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mount Barker is 60-69 years. Households in Mount Barker are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mount Barker work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 71.10% of the homes in Mount Barker were owner-occupied compared with 67.30% in 2016.
